We recently bought an established 12g nano, mostly with zoos, macro algae,and 3 snails. No fish. Do the snails have to be fed? I would think they would be OK without it.

No the snails do not have to be fed. They will live off of the algae just fine. Is this your tank or T's?

if they're the scavenging kind of snails, like nassarius, I believe you should probably give them SOMETHING to munch on once in awhile.
